Résumé du poste
*Job Overview* Join our dynamic kitchen team as a Full or Part-Time Kitchen Staff member and become a vital part of creating memorable dining experiences! In this energetic role, you will be responsible for preparing delicious meals, maintaining high standards of food safety, and supporting the overall operation of our busy kitchen. Whether you're passionate about cooking, enjoy working in a fast-paced environment, or have previous restaurant experience, this position offers an exciting opportunity to develop your skills and contribute to a vibrant food service setting. We value dedication, teamwork, and a positive attitude?if that sounds like you, we want to hear from you! *Duties* * Assist in meal preparation and food handling to ensure timely and quality service * Follow food safety protocols to maintain cleanliness and hygiene standards in all kitchen areas * Prepare ingredients and assemble dishes according to established recipes and standards * Support the serving team by ensuring smooth flow of food from kitchen to table * Maintain organized workstations, including cleaning utensils, equipment, and work surfaces regularly * Collaborate with team members to meet service goals during busy hours * Adhere to all health and safety regulations to promote a safe working environment *Qualifications* * Previous experience in a restaurant or food service environment is preferred but not required * Basic cooking skills and knowledge of meal preparation techniques * Familiarity with food handling procedures and food safety standards * 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ced setting while maintaining attention to detail * Strong teamwork and communication skills * Willingness to learn new skills and adapt to changing priorities in the kitchen environment * Flexibility to work various shifts, including evenings, weekends, or holidays as needed Pay: From $17.00 per hour Benefits: * Discounted or free food * Flexible schedule * On-site parking Work Location: In person
